On Mon, 19 Aug 2024 at 03:43, Gaskell, Oliver <[email protected]> wrote: > > Enabling CONFIG_DM_SEQ_ALIAS enables code which relies on > `trailing_strtol()` - which is only linked in SPL when CONFIG_SPL_STRTO > is enabled. > > CONFIG_SPL_STRTO is not enabled by default - to ensure this function is > available in SPL, CONFIG_SPL_DM_SEQ_ALIAS should select > CONFIG_SPL_STRTO. > > Signed-off-by: Oliver Gaskell <[email protected]> > --- > > drivers/core/Kconfig | 1 + > 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)
Reviewed-by: Simon Glass <[email protected]> > > diff --git a/drivers/core/Kconfig b/drivers/core/Kconfig > index 1a7be4d9b4..c39abe3bc9 100644 > --- a/drivers/core/Kconfig > +++ b/drivers/core/Kconfig > @@ -146,6 +146,7 @@ config DM_SEQ_ALIAS > config SPL_DM_SEQ_ALIAS > bool "Support numbered aliases in device tree in SPL" > depends on SPL_DM > + select SPL_STRTO > help > Most boards will have a '/aliases' node containing the path to > numbered devices (e.g. serial0 = &serial0).
